Polo for a Purpose is a polo match with a purpose: all funds raised at the event are donated to pediatric cancer patients and their families.

It’s January 20th at the International Polo Club in Wellington.

This annual family event is the passion of Champion Polo Player Brandon Phillips, who at 14 was fighting non Hodgkin’s lymphoma and was given weeks to live.

Since its inception in 2014, Polo for Life has raised more than a million dollars that’s been donated locally to not only work to find a cure for childhood cancers, but to help patients and families impacted by cancer.

This year’s event will benefit 5 local charities including the Kid’s Cancer Foundation in Royal Palm Beach, the Pediatric Oncology Support Team in West Palm Beach, and Joe DiMaggio Children’s Foundation (which has a medical facility in Wellington).

Brandon joined us to talk about the event, his non-profit Polo for Life and his battle with cancer and how he's overcome it.
